What is a Cuban cuisine chef?

Cuban cuisine chefs are culinary professionals who specialize in preparing and cooking traditional Cuban dishes. They have expertise in blending Spanish, African, and Caribbean flavors, using staple ingredients such as rice, beans, pork, plantains, and tropical spices. These chefs often work in restaurants, catering services, or as private chefs, and they focus on authentic recipes like ropa vieja, picadillo, and lechón asado. Their role involves not only cooking but also presenting Cuban food culture to diners.

What are some common challenges chefs face when working in a Cuban cuisine restaurant?

Chefs specializing in Cuban cuisine often encounter challenges such as sourcing authentic ingredients, which may not always be readily available outside of Cuba. Additionally, mastering traditional cooking techniques and flavors requires in-depth knowledge and experience, as many dishes rely on slow-cooking and precise seasoning. Working in a Cuban kitchen also means collaborating closely with other team members to ensure consistency and authenticity in every dish, all while managing a fast-paced environment, especially during peak dining hours.
